thyssenkrupp greenlights construction of €2B hydrogen-powered direct reduction plant for low-CO2 steel

Green Car Congress

In this way, thyssenkrupp is accelerating the start of low-CO2 steel production. With its capacity of 2.5 million metric tons of direct reduced iron, the first plant will be larger than initially planned.

Kobe Steel to launch “Kobenable Steel”, Japan’s first low-CO2 blast furnace steel

Green Car Congress

Kobe Steel will launch “Kobenable Steel” and become Japan’s first provider of low-CO 2 blast furnace steel products with significantly reduced CO 2 emissions during the blast furnace ironmaking process. The company plans to start selling the new products this fiscal year.

Volkswagen Group and Salzgitter AG sign MOU on supply of low-CO2 steel from the end of 2025

Green Car Congress

The Volkswagen Group and Salzgitter AG—which have been partners for more than 60 years— signed a Memorandum of Understanding under which Volkswagen will become one of the first customers for the low-CO 2 steel that Salzgitter AG plans to produce on a new production route at its headquarters in Lower Saxony from the end of 2025.

Report: Light pole EV charging is the low-CO2 solution for cities

Green Car Reports

A company that installs EV chargers in streetlights claims this is not only a practical way to bring charging to urban areas, but also has a lower carbon footprint than conventional charging installations. That's the conclusion of a study commissioned by U.K.-based based streetlight charging company ChargeLight and conducted by consultancy.
